How has been the historical performance of Pratiksha Chem.?
Pratiksha Chem. initially showed growth in net sales and profits, with net sales increasing from 8.16 Cr in 2011 to 11.13 Cr in 2012. However, by March 2025, the company faced significant financial decline, with total liabilities and assets both dropping to 3.35 Cr and a negative book value per share of -7.24, indicating deteriorating financial stability.

Pratiksha Chemicals: Micro-Cap Specialty Chemical Maker Faces Severe Distress Amid Negative Equity and Promoter Exit
Pratiksha Chemicals Ltd., an Ahmedabad-based manufacturer of Pigment Green 7 and Copper Phthalocyanine Green Crude, finds itself in severe financial distress with a market capitalisation of merely ₹11.49 crores and a negative book value of ₹7.24 per share. The micro-cap specialty chemicals company has witnessed a dramatic 40.18% decline in promoter holding from 43.30% in March 2025 to just 3.12% in September 2025, signalling a potential loss of confidence from the founding group. The stock trades at ₹20.63, posting a sharp 9.97% gain on November 6, 2025, though it remains down 8.72% over the past year and has underperformed the Sensex by 12.74% during this period.
